Output dfd55ba59b5fd4a834ea545f4fd89d5c51a9048ba168e971fa71c12d0cfe78d9:106

value
158387
script pubkey
OP_0 OP_PUSHBYTES_32 b61caf7e81d296f20ab9c9025d97474d7a4a4d57942e223934abc3f6716ca631
address
bc1qkcw27l5p62t0yz4eeyp9m968f4ay5n2hjshzywf540plvutv5ccsr3snlq
transaction
dfd55ba59b5fd4a834ea545f4fd89d5c51a9048ba168e971fa71c12d0cfe78d9